If you’re into the entertainment world, high chances are you’ve heard about ‘loyalty free music. For those who might not know, this simply refers to music written and produced with the main intention of being used in another project. It is then that you can license it for a fee, to use in their project.
But have you ever wondered who needs to license music? To give you a tip of the iceberg, any person who happens to be creating digital content with the main intention of publishing it online or publicly needs to get a license. That aside, here are some of the most notable reasons why you should prioritize licensing royalty free music.
You Can Monetize the Content You Produce
When looking forward to producing the content for your own online channel on YouTube, then you’ll definitely be entered into the partner program. This action is aimed at making sure you earn money from any ads displayed on the videos. Keep in mind you can never earn money from these ads if the music is not licensed. In this case, the money goes straight to the producer or artist of the music.
